Bryce Sadtler is Associate Professor of Chemistry at Washington University in St. Louis, leading research on inorganic nanostructures and catalytic transformations. His group develops advanced imaging techniques to study chemical reactions at the nanoscale and synthesizes metastable materials using solution-phase methods.
Research Areas:
- Single-particle imaging of photocatalytic activity
- Growth of adaptive inorganic nanostructures
- Solution-phase synthesis of metastable semiconductor compounds
His publications emphasize nanomaterial synthesis, surface reaction dynamics, and energy conversion mechanisms. Award recognition includes an NSF CAREER Award and Emerging Investigator designations for contributions to materials chemistry.
